Intel is seeking a highly motivated and experienced Post‑Silicon Validation Engineer to join the team and play a critical role in ensuring the quality and functionality of cutting‑edge CPU products for laptops, desktops, and gaming systems.

You will work at the heart of innovation, contributing to the validation of complex CPU/SOC architectures and ensuring products meet the highest standards of reliability and performance.

Key Responsibilities (Include, But Are Not Limited To)
  • Develop and execute validation plans to verify CPU/SOC functionality, power, and thermal management across multiple silicon platforms
  • Design, implement, and debug validation tests and methodologies for post-silicon environments
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ams, including design, firmware, software, and manufacturing, to identify and resolve issues
  • Analyze and debug CPU/SOC and system-level issues using advanced tools and methodologies
  • Lead debug task forces to root‑cause and resolve issues impacting program milestones
  • Drive validation automation, coverage improvement, and process efficiency for validation execution
  • Work with internal stakeholders to ensure smooth integration and delivery of products to the market
